Farooq Abdullah calls upon Pak over ceasefire violation

The Former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ister and National Conference chief, Farooq Abdullah called upon Pakistan to stop ceasefire violation, saying that it would only lead everyone to destruction.

Abdullah’s statement comes after 11 civilians were injured in various sectors of Jammu and Kashmir, after Pakistan violated multiple ceasefires along the Line of Control (LoC).

“Not only BSF jawans but civilians also got injured in these ceasefire violations. It is a tremendous tragedy that is taking place at our border. I hope our neighbor realizes that it is not going to take us anywhere other than destruction,” he told the media.

Earlier on Friday, a 17 year-old-girl was killed in a ceasefire violation by the Pakistani troops in RS Pura sector of the state.
